Ward 5 Clean Sweep Day

On Saturday, May 5th the Malden DPW will be coming to Ward 5 for a specially scheduled sidewalk cleaning and street-sweeping project. Sponsored by Ward 5 Councillor Barbara Murphy & the City of Malden DPW(Rain date: Saturday, May 12th, 2012)

Let’s work together and get a jump-start on Ward 5 spring cleaning. On Saturday, May 5th the Malden DPW will be coming to Ward 5 for a specially scheduled sidewalk cleaning and street-sweeping project. In order to have the greatest impact, it is going to take community involvement...your involvement!!! Here’s how you can help:

• Remove weeds from crevices in sidewalks and surrounding areas.

• Sweep your sidewalk into the street in advance of the scheduled time for your street.

• Make sure your vehicle(s) are not parked on the street until after the sweeper has nished on your street.

• Become a Street/Neighborhood Captain to make sure all goes smoothly in your area.

• Lend a hand to an elderly or disabled neighbor. 

Please Note: there will NOT be yard or waste pick-up on this day. Street sweepers are not equipped to pick up yardwaste, so, please do not put leaves and grass clipping on the street as it will likely clog the sweeper and ruin the day. Beginning at 9:00 , three teams of sweepers will work simultaneously throughout Ward 5 following pre-determined routes.  If you do not have a flyer you can find the information on the City of Malden Website www.cityofmalden.org or call me at 781-910-8088.
